Anyone know the ohms for a coil for my '78 750B. I need a new coil. I am hoping to find one at a local HD dealer for a decent price.

3 ohms and don't worry about the multiple posts, it gives me something to do

So what is the range of ohm's i should look for in a coil? Can I go with a 2.4 ohm coil a 4ohm coil?

Since it's a points type ignition it's not really critical, just stay above two ohms (or use a ballast resister with the coil) and below 4 ohms.
